Output 902631011ddd653017c89439a510dbb5f99f9fa83828034b3fd960cfd782f762:4

value
2380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67ff6b53600fe506741c851686b7cd4c76cb9a19 OP_EQUAL
address
3BAuW9CrZ9yHwtvLbVxSfTaU1ViBKvoBMQ
transaction
902631011ddd653017c89439a510dbb5f99f9fa83828034b3fd960cfd782f762
spent
true